Maria Gemskie is a corporate communications professional with the Allstate. Previously, she was with the CME Group.[1] Also, before the CME-CBOT merger, she was head of corporate communications for the Chicago Board of Trade.[2]
Background
Prior to joining the CBOT, Gemskie served the U.S. House of Representatives in Washington D.C. from 1996 to 1999 as Communications Director for former U.S. Congressman Thomas Ewing.[3]
After the CBOT conducted their initial public offering, Gemskie penned a newsletter article for the NYSE Newsletter titled "Futures Exchange Forges into the Future; Chicago Board of Trade Goes Public.[4]
In February of 2006, Gemskie presented a presentation for IABC Chicago titled, "Professional Development Luncheon: Preparing Communication and PR plans for an IPO: Lessons learned and tips any communicator can use."[5]
Education
Gemskie holds a B.S. in Public Affairs from Indiana University, Bloomington, IN. [6][7]
